Job Description

Office Manager, Lower or Upper Academy RISE Prep Mayoral Academy (RI) Woonsocket, RI Job Details Full-time 4 hours ago Qualifications High school diploma or GED Productivity software
Technical Proficiency Full Job Description Responsibilities:
The Office Manager serves as a primary first point of contact for families and visitors to RISE Prep schools, by phone and in person. The Office Manager is a critical member of the school's Operations Team and reports directly to the Dean of School Operations. Specific roles and responsibilities may include but are not limited to the following, Serve as the lead on all key office responsibilities, including: mail, maintenance coordination, program and appointment scheduling, family events, logistical support, etc. Manage the Main Office in regards to filing, visitors, and internal and external school communications Provide administrative and operational support to team members and support families with informational or logistical questions Maintain accurate attendance records, including scholar and teacher data Manage and organize school supplies and storage and manage key operational systems as directed by the Dean of Operations or requested by other School/Network leaders
